City Guide for Lake Shore, WA

Lake Shore is located near the Fort Vancouver National Historic Site, established in 1824, which marks the location of the Hudson Bay Company's largest fur trading post west of the Rocky Mountains, considered the most important activity center for the settlement of the entire U.S. west coast. This is the location where American settlers first arrived after traversing the Oregon Trail and received supplies that allowed them to survive their first months in the unfamiliar west.

Lake Shore, Washington is a tiny suburban area covering just 1.6 square miles, but it's located on the northern edge of the city of Vancouver, which has a population of 165,000 and is considered part of the Portland, OR metropolitan statistical area. Lake Shore is a census designated place in the southwest corner of Washington state on the eastern shore of Vancouver Lake. Locals consider Lake Shore to be a neighborhood of Vancouver just like communities to the east, Starcrest and Hazel Dell North. In fact, when you live here you get a Vancouver address. How neat is that? Lake Shore ranks 63rd out of 522 areas of Washington in per-capita income, and you're going to find a lot of newer, larger rental homes options here. Lake Shore lies about five minutes away from the banks of the Columbia River, which if you follow it west will lead you to the Pacific Ocean or to the east up the Columbia River Gorge and some of the most under-rated, breath-taking scenery in all of the U.S. This community also is a little more than an hour's drive away from skiing on Mt. Hood, and about the same distance from hiking, camping, mountain biking, fishing and other outdoor recreational pursuits at Mt. St. Helens. Yes, that Mt. St. Helens. What to keep in mind when looking for apartments with garages in Lake Shore, WA

Lake Shore apartments with garages are sometimes more expensive than other options. However, they may make more financial sense in the long run.

Weather, break-ins, and daily struggles to find a space can take a toll financially and physically. Remember that even cities in mild climates experience issues like salt air, tornadoes, hail, falling branches from storms, and other issues.

It’s also possible to score an auto insurance reduction if you park in a garage. Ask your insurance provider about any deals or discounts that could trim money off the cost of your monthly bill.

Before signing a lease, ask the landlord or property manager about any restrictions on garage use. It’s important to know if there are enough spaces for tenants and visitors and what happens if the garage is full. If you’re moving into an apartment inside a home, ask about any conditions on its use and if storage is allowed.
